We live in Deanfield Road, directly below Harcourt Close (approx. 15 feet above). Heavy rain in the summer has, on several occasions, overwhelmed the four drains at the cul-de-sac end of Harcourt Close. The resulting torrent of water has washed away the soil from the top of our garden, it then cascades down and floods the garden round the house to a depth of several inches. We suspect that the four drains are partially blocked and would like to know when they will next be cleaned. If this isn’t scheduled for the very near future, are you able to supply sandbags for us to create a barrier at the top of the garden? Many thanks.
